how do I determine the domain for this function with showing my work: f(x)= x-5/2x-3

Respuesta :

Sophia093 Sophia093
  • 03-04-2020

Answer:

(-∞, [tex]\frac{3}{2}[/tex]) ∪ ( [tex]\frac{3}{2}[/tex], ∞)

Step-by-step explanation:

Since x ≠ 3/2, this tells us that x could be any number but 3/2; that's why we use ( ) and not [ ]. We only use [ ] if it is included in the domain.
